HISTORY:
Havana: In January of 1983 Bishop Hernandez and representatives
from the Holy Trinity
Cathedral in Havana visited Jacksonville and became members of the Cross
of Nails. In 1988 a Cross of Nails chapter was formed at the Holy Trinity
Cathedral in Cuba. In September of l990 Vice Provost Michael Sadgrove from
Coventry Cathedral, Executive Secretary Charles Kiblinger, and the Spruills from
Jacksonville visited the Cathedral in Havana to present a Cross of Nails.
Santiago: In September of 2000 Joachim von Koelichen from Coventry Cathedral and the Spruills from Jacksonville Cathedral took a Cross of Nails and 100 Spanish Prayer Books to St. Mary's Church in Santiago, Cuba.
ACTIVITIES: At Holy Trinity Cathedral in Havana, Cuba, noontime prayers and the Litany of Reconciliation are read daily.
Meetings: In Santiago de Cuba the Cross of Nails chapter of St. Mary's Church meets monthly for bible study, prayers and a common meal.
Projects/Events: A group of Presbyterian members of the Cross of Nails USA were welcomed at the cathedral in December, 2001.
For the past several years summer camps involving youth and young adults have been held to explore the concept of Reconciliation. These gatherings attract youth from all over the island and have been held in Santiago de Cuba and in Havana.
